Title: The C-terminal domain of rice beta-galactosidase 1 PubMed: 27451952
Deposition date: 2016-02-22 Original release date: 2016-08-08
Authors: Rimlumduan, T.; Hua, Y.-l.; Tanaka, T.; Ketudat-Cairns, J.R.
Citation: Rimlumduan, T.; Hua, Y.-l.; Tanaka, T.; Ketudat-Cairns, J.R.. "Structure of a plant beta-galactosidase C-terminal domain" Biochim. Biophys. Acta 1864, 1411-1418 (2016).
Assembly members:
entity_1, polymer, 122 residues,   13029.779 Da.
Natural source: Common Name: Rice Taxonomy ID: 39946 Superkingdom: Eukaryota Kingdom: Metazoa Genus/species: Oryza sativa
Experimental source: Production method: recombinant technology Host organism: Escherichia coli

Samples:
sample_1: D2O, [U-2H], 5%; H2O 95%; OsBGal1 Cter 0.5 mM; sodium chloride 100 mM; sodium phosphate 20 mM
sample_2: D2O, [U-2H], 100%; OsBGal1 Cter 0.54 mM; sodium chloride 100 mM; sodium phosphate 20 mM
sample_3: D2O, [U-2H], 5%; H2O 95%; OsBGal1 Cter, [U-100% 15N], 0.79 mM; sodium chloride 100 mM; sodium phosphate 20 mM
sample_4: D2O, [U-2H], 5%; H2O 95%; OsBGal1 Cter, [U-100% 13C; U-100% 15N], 0.5 mM; sodium chloride 100 mM; sodium phosphate 20 mM
sample_5: D2O, [U-2H], 5%; H2O 95%; OsBGal1 Cter, [U-10% 13C], 0.18 mM; sodium chloride 100 mM; sodium phosphate 20 mM
sample_conditions_1: ionic strength: 120 mM; pH: 7.4; pressure: 1 atm; temperature: 298 K
